WebPosterior – posterior to the posterior axillary line (vertical line through the tip of the scapula) Flail segment – three of more consecutive ribs with two or more fractures in each rib without clinical paradoxical chest wall movement (i.e. radiographic flail) Flail chest – three or more consecutive ribs with two or more fractures in each ... An injury to the ribs can cause bruising or fracture, with blunt force trauma (as with a fall or auto accident) being the top cause of rib fractures. Because of the rib anatomy, most fractures occur in ribs seven through 10.

Posterior rib fractures occur when the child's chest is compressed. … sonic mockl slushiesWebNov 1, 2012 · We report on a 21-day-old infant with healing posterior rib fractures that were noted after a chiropractic visit for colic. Chiropractors are the third largest group of health care professionals in the United States, and colic is the leading complaint for pediatric chiropractic care.
